Donburi Dish Options

The donburi dish options offered as part of the cooking class provide participants a chance to savor the flavors of iconic Japanese comfort foods.

Visitors can choose from a selection of beloved donburi varieties, each showcasing the freshly sourced ingredients from Nishiki Market.

Kaisen-don, a vibrant seafood bowl, features an array of seasonal catch artfully arranged over steamed rice.

For those craving a crispy delight, the Ten-don option tempts with golden tempura morsels nestled in the bowl.

The Oyako-don, meanwhile, combines tender chicken and rich, runny egg in a harmonious union.

Whichever dish they select, participants can look forward to crafting a meal that captures the essence of Nishiki Market’s renowned culinary bounty.

Included in the Tour

Included in the comprehensive tour fee are a wealth of delights, from the opportunity to sample the market’s unique delicacies to the cost of transportation from the bustling market to the intimate cooking studio.

Visitors will be treated to a guided exploration of Nishiki Market, where an English-fluent local Japanese guide will share insights into the market’s history and the distinctive ingredients that make their way into the cooking demonstration.

Beyond the market tour, the experience includes:

  • A hands-on cooking class, where you will learn to prepare a delectable donburi dish using fresh ingredients sourced directly from the market.
  • A provided recipe to recreate the dish at home.
  • Complimentary food tastings throughout the tour.
